The Technical Skills You'll Learn in Plumbing Training
Plumbing training courses are offered at trade colleges all over the UK as well as other parts of the world. They are also offered online as well. Plumbing remains in high need as well as regulates high salaries. Plumbing training courses can be your path to monetary and also job success.Plumbing is among the most reputable and a lot of specialized set of abilities in the building and also construction solutions trades. Plumbing professionals are vital and also wear numerous hats. Plumbing training courses educate them exactly how to aid make water run efficiently, keep bathrooms purging correctly, wastewater properly dealt with and pipelines staying safe without leaks.Plumbers can install or fix hot water heater, repair icy or burst or leaking pipelines. Obviously, plumbing training courses will instruct prospective plumbing specialists to set up pipelines and other components in new houses incomplete as well.
There are lots of parts of a brand-new residence the repair work as well as servicing of which can just be accomplished by a correctly educated and also licensed plumber.Online plumbing programs can lead the way, sometimes and locations practical to the trainee, for a financially rewarding and satisfying profession in the plumbing trade.
One on the internet institution that we read used plumbing training courses whose examinations were all open publication and also open notes. The pupils discovered their plumbing training courses at their very own speed as well as were able to graduate in as few as six months. Graduation after finishing all the requisite plumbing training courses gives the trainees with a diploma with nationwide accreditation.No prerequisites or related experience is required to register in this trade institution. At that is needed to discover the plumbing trade, besides acceptable passing of all plumbing courses, is the ability to use simple trade devices, contentment from a work dealing with your hands as well as the motivation to venture out there and also market yourself.
Plumbing courses at this college consist of soldering copper pipes, plumbing basics such as installment as well as leak repairs, tap fundamentals, valve fixing and also supply of water systems. Plumbing technology 101, the initial program, describes the standard of the plumbing profession. The goal of this initial program is to instruct pupils the basics of the profession or to acquaint property owners with some do-it-yourself techniques.Many of the concerns attended to in this very first of the plumbing courses are those that will certainly turn up nearly every day in a plumbing professionals function life. These consist of the system that provides a domestic or business building with water, soldering, vents and also drains, installment of plumbing associated fixtures as well as repair of the very same. The specifics of the course include a take a look at fundamental plumbing safety ideas and orientation with the jargon and also basic regards to the plumbing trade. Soldering is a fundamental part of this plumbing program too.After this lesson each pupil ought to have the ability to select the appropriate soldering products, clean the steels to get them all set for soldering, prepare the joint and solder a tubes connection the correct and secure way.Water service becomes part of this basic course products and training. Pupils discover the layout of a house or commercial cellar, the ins and outs of selecting the appropriate materials and also the appropriate location of the needed equipment.Students learn to mount a drain, along with a ventilation and also waste system. They also learn more about setting up components in these on the internet plumbing training courses.


HOW TO BECOME A PLUMBER


Get your high school diploma or GED.


A plumber needs a foundation in math (i.e., algebra and geometry), science (i.e., physics) and computers (i.e., computer-aided drafting). If offered, you may also want to take classes in drafting and blueprint reading.


Get formal training.


Complete an apprenticeship program or training at a local trade school.


Get licensed.


A majority of states require that you have a plumber’s license. Although licensing standards aren’t uniform, 2-5 years of experience and passage of an exam of the plumbing trades and local codes are typical requirements.


Get working.



Residential service careers are in demand all over the country.
